How about valid SSL certificate covering your domain at your web server/origin host?

Steps for troubleshooting:

  1. Use the “Pause Cloudflare on Site” option from the Overview tab for your domain at dash.cloudflare.com .
  2. The link is in the lower right corner of that page.
  3. Give it five minutes to take effect, then make sure site is working as expected with HTTPS without any error
  4. Check with your hosting provider / Plesk panel / cPanel AutoSSL / Let’s Encrypt / ACME / Certbot and manually click to renew it
  5. Only then, when your website responds over HTTPS, you should un-pause Cloudflare and double-check your SSL/TLS setting to make sure it’s set to Full (Strict).
